What reflector should I use for portraits?

Black Reflector – Black reflectors are used to add “negative fill.” Use the black reflector to reduce the amount of light around your subject. Black reflectors are generally used with portraits on the left and right side of the subject to give them more depth.

How big of a reflector do I need?

The ideal size of reflector is the SAME size as the area you are trying to reflect light into, assuming you have the room to get it in there. So, if you are lighting a 3/4 length shot of a single person, you need a reflector that is 3/4 the height of a person.

Which metal reflects light the best?

Silver, for instance, has high reflectivity over the visible range of the spectrum, which makes it colorless when white light is focused on the metal. Gold, however, absorbs the blue and violet regions of the spectrum, leading to a yellow color when illuminated with white light.

How do you use a reflector for indoor photography?

Simply place a reflector opposite of your main light source for great, bounced fill light. You can also place a reflector in the subject’s lap, or just in front of them at an angle, to soften all of the sharp features and shadows under the eyes and chin.

What reflects more white or silver?

Silver reflects much more light, so you’ll use silver when you position the reflector back away from your subject. If you need to get a reflector right up close, then use white, because it doesn’t reflect nearly as much light as silver.

Which Colour is the best reflector?

White light contains all the wavelengths of the visible spectrum, so when the color white is being reflected, that means all wavelengths are being reflected and none of them absorbed, making white the most reflective color.

Which Colour is most reflective? Pure white, being the most reflective color, is at the other end of the scale at 100 because it doesn’t absorb light or warmth. Colors that fall below 50 on the LRV scale will absorb more light than they reflect.
